About the Role
We are a content creation startup looking for a creative, technically skilled, and deadline-driven Video Editor to join our team.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ys working with gaming content, and understands how to create engaging videos for modern digital audiences.
You'll be responsible for producing high-quality long-form and short-form content across multiple platforms while helping shape the visual identity of our brand.
Key Responsibilities
- Edit engaging long-form and short-form video content for YouTube, TikTok, Instagram, Facebook, and other digital platforms.
- Deliver high-quality edits within agreed deadlines while maintaining consistency and attention to detail.
- Create compelling storytelling through pacing, sound design, transitions, motion graphics, and colour correction.
- Collaborate remotely with content creators and clients.
- Optimise content for different social media platforms and audience engagement.
- Organise and manage project files efficiently.
- Apply feedback quickly and professionally.
- Stay up to date with editing trends, gaming culture, and emerging content styles.
Essential Requirements
- 2–5 years of professional video editing experience.
- Demonstrated experience editing both long-form and short-form content.
- Strong portfolio showcasing a range of editing styles and completed projects (applications without a portfolio will not be considered).
- Solid understanding of gaming culture, gaming communities, military history and gaming-related content is beneficial.
- Proficiency in industry-standard editing software such as Adobe Premiere Pro, DaVinci Resolve, Final Cut Pro, or similar.
- Strong understanding of audio editing, colour grading, and video optimisation.
- Ability to manage multiple projects and meet tight deadlines.
- Excellent communication skills in a remote working environment.
- Must own a reliable computer/workstation capable of professional video editing.
- Must have access to licensed editing software and a stable high-speed internet connection.
